It seems most people prefer the 1993 Suns/Bulls final to the 1997 one, but I have to respectfully disagree. The 1997 classic between the Jazz and the Bulls was full of high drama. You had Michael Jordan's game-winner in Game 1, John Stockton's steal and pass in Game 4, the flu game in Game 5 and Steve Kerr's shot in Game 6. You had the league's MVP playing against the game's greatest player. You had close games. You had two teams that would never again be as good. They did meet again in 1998, but that wasn't nearly as much of a series.

This is Game 6, and oops, I kind of gave away the ending. Enjoy.
